Day 2: Amman | Dana | Hike to Mansoura

The drive to the starting point of our trek takes about 2.5 hours so you will depart early this morning from the hotel. During the drive, bond with your fellow hikers or catch a quick power nap before the exhilarating journey begins.

Our trekking adventure will take us through the wondrous landscapes of Dana Biosphere Reserve. This reserve boasts four distinct ecozones, housing a breathtaking diversity of flora, fauna, and avifauna. Our first trail will lead us along the majestic mountains overlooking the awe-inspiring Dana Valley before we make our way down into the enchanting al-Khashasha Valley. Here, we will set up a wilderness campsite on the outskirts of the valley, where we can marvel at the picturesque scenery and unwind under the starry sky. 

Hiking time: 5-7 hours
Distance: 15 KM
Ascent: 260m
Descent: 690m

Day 3: Mansoura | Furon

Bid farewell to Mansoura and set our sights on a breathtaking hike through the valleys that overlook the magnificent Wadi Araba. Our destination? The majestic Furon.

The hike may be steep and challenging, but the rewards are worth every step. As we ascend up through the mountains, we'll be treated to awe-inspiring views that will leave you spellbound. The dramatic valley we'll traverse through offers stunning vistas of the vibrant Wadi Araba Desert that will take your breath away.

After an invigorating morning, we'll take a well-deserved break at our campsite, set up by our amazing crew at Furon. The afternoon promises to be just as exciting as we continue our adventure through the rugged terrain of this beautiful region.

Difficulty Level: Difficult
Hiking Time: 5-7 hrs 
Hiking Distance: 14Km 
Ascent: 563m 
Descent: 170m

Day 4: Furon | Ghbour Whedat

Set out on the rugged terrain of Furon and trek past Ras Al-Feid towards Ghbour Whedat. Brace yourself for the breathtaking panoramas that will unfold before your eyes, as we explore some of the most remote and untamed corners of Jordan.

Traverse the Sharah Mountains and follow the well-worn paths of Bedouin shepherds. Marvel at the towering peaks of black mountains that loom above us, while the steep canyons below create a dramatic backdrop that will leave you in awe.

As we gradually ascend the hills, we will be rewarded with more stunning views of the desert below. And when the day draws to a close, we will set up camp in the wilderness of Ghbour Whedat, immersing ourselves in the beauty of the natural surroundings. 

Hiking Level: Difficult
Hiking Distance: 17.1Km
Ascent: 750m
Descent: 920m
 

Day 5: Ghbour Whedat | Little Petra

As we continue our journey toward Little Petra, the landscape begins to shift and we start to see more signs of human activity. Along the way, we'll encounter Bedouin camps, sheep pens, and small farms, all of which give us a glimpse into the daily lives of local residents.

As we approach the area between Ghbour Whedat and Little Petra, we'll be treated to a fascinating display of Nabatean ruins, including old wine and olive presses, aqueducts, and other impressive feats of ancient engineering. It's incredible to think about the level of sophistication and ingenuity required to create such complex water systems so long ago.

Today's highlight, of course, is Little Petra, a "suburb" of the legendary Petra that was once home to traders traveling along the famous Silk Road. As we explore this fascinating site, we'll marvel at the rock-carved facades, ancient houses, and other incredible sandstone structures that were crafted by skilled hands thousands of years ago.

Hiking Level: Moderate
Hiking Distance: 14Km
Ascent: 610m
Descent: 560m

Day 6: Little Petra | Petra

  • Hotel
  • 1 Breakfast, 1 Lunch, 1 Dinner
After a hearty breakfast, take the lesser-known route via 'The Back Door', where you'll be able to avoid the crowds and truly immerse yourself in the beauty of Petra. The well-maintained tracks will lead you through the breathtaking Wadi Ghurab, surrounded by stunning sandstone mountains that guard the entrance to Petra.

As you follow the Nabataean route out of the valley, you'll come across a natural rock terrace that has been thoughtfully upgraded for your safety. While the path may narrow slightly, don't worry - the views from the hidden plateau above Wadi Siyyagh will take your breath away.

As you continue onwards, you'll suddenly catch sight of 'The Monastery', a magnificent structure carved into the cliff face. If you're feeling peckish, stop by the Bedouin café for some refreshments before descending down the Nabataean steps and into ancient Petra.

From there, you'll exit past the famous 'Petra Siq' and into the bustling Wadi Musa, home to an array of shops, cafés, and hotels. 

Hiking Distance: 14Km to 16KM
